An artificial neural network uses the human brain as inspiration for creating a complex machine learning system. There are now neural networks that can classify millions of sounds, videos, and images. These machines can answer our questions, understand our behaviors, and even drive our cars. The network looks for subtle patterns in our data and then fine-tunes itself to improve over time. They can become experts in predicting our behavior, learning our languages, and finding new discoveries.
